The UL16-binding protein (ULBP) family, comprising ULBP1 through ULBP6, represents a group of cell surface glycoproteins that are structurally related to MHC class I molecules and serve as ligands for the activating immune receptor NKG2D, which is expressed on natural killer (NK) cells and certain T-cell subsets. ULBPs are stress-induced ligands, upregulated in response to cellular stress such as infection or transformation, triggering activation signals in NK cells or cytotoxic T lymphocytes, leading to immune effector functions including cytotoxicity against target cells. High expression of certain ULBPs has been observed in various hematologic malignancies and solid tumors making them attractive targets for immunotherapeutic strategies such as CAR-T therapies targeting NKG2D ligands. HCMV can evade this mechanism through the protein UL16.
ULBPs engage NKG2D receptors → activate DAP10 adaptor → trigger downstream signaling cascades: JAK/STAT, ERK/MAPK, PI3K/Akt. This leads to enhanced NK cell-mediated lysis, increased cytokine secretion (especially IFN-gamma when synergizing with IL‑12), and overcoming inhibitory signals from self-MHC recognition by NK cells.
